In today’s digital landscape, a compelling web presence is crucial for business success. Web design & development are at the heart of this, integrating creative design with robust functionality to create websites that not only attract but engage users.
Understanding the Basics – Web Design & Development
Web design focuses on the aesthetic aspects of a site—everything from layout and color schemes to typography and user interface design. On the other hand, web development deals with the site’s structure, using code and programming to bring design concepts to life. So, combining both effectively results in a seamless user experience.
Current Trends in Web Design
This year, web design is all about simplicity and speed. Clean, minimalist layouts dominate, with bold typography and ample whitespace ensuring content readability. Additionally, dark mode and light mode options are increasingly prevalent, catering to user preferences for viewing website content in different lighting environments.
Advancements in Web Development
The rise of Progressive Web Apps (PWAs) continues to blur the lines between web and mobile apps, offering fast and responsive user experiences. Additionally, APIs and serverless technology are taking center stage, helping developers create dynamic and scalable web applications.
Best Practices for Web Design & Development
To build an effective website, focus on user-centric design. Also, prioritize site speed and mobile responsiveness, as these are critical to user engagement and search engine rankings. So, incorporate SEO best practices from the ground up, ensuring your site is easily discoverable by search engines.
Looking Ahead: Future of Web Design & Development
The future promises even more integration of AI and machine learning, personalizing user experiences like never before. Additionally, voice search optimization is becoming essential as more users turn to voice-activated devices for browsing.
The Role of User Experience (UX) in Web Design – Web Design & Development
Definition of UX:
User Experience (UX) encompasses the overall interaction a user has with a website, including usability, aesthetics, content, and the emotions triggered during their journey. So, it focuses on how effectively and efficiently users can achieve their goals, emphasizing a seamless, intuitive experience.
Importance of UX:
A positive UX is crucial as it leads to:
- Higher User Satisfaction: Users are more likely to return to websites that are easy to navigate and visually appealing.
- Lower Bounce Rates: A well-designed UX keeps visitors engaged, reducing the likelihood of them leaving the site shortly after arriving.
- Increased Conversions: When users find what they’re looking for easily, they are more likely to complete desired actions, such as making a purchase or signing up for a newsletter.
Key UX Principles:
- Usability: Ensures that a website is easy to use and navigate.
- Accessibility: Guarantees that all users, regardless of ability or disability, can access content.
- User Feedback: Involves gathering user insights to continually improve the site based on real user experiences.
Examples:
- Airbnb: The site’s intuitive design and personalized experiences lead to higher user engagement and conversion rates.
- Amazon: Its user-friendly interface, including clear product descriptions and easy navigation, contributes to its status as one of the most successful e-commerce platforms.
Integrating Accessibility in Web Design
Understanding Accessibility:
Web accessibility refers to the practice of making websites usable for people with disabilities. Also, it ensures that all users have equal access to information and services online, promoting inclusivity.
Legal Considerations:
Legal requirements, such as the Americans with Disabilities Act (ADA), mandate that public websites be accessible to individuals with disabilities, potentially leading to legal ramifications for non-compliance.
Guidelines and Standards:
- WCAG (Web Content Accessibility Guidelines): These guidelines provide a framework for making web content more accessible, including principles like perceivable, operable, understandable, and robust.
Tools and Resources:
- Screen Readers: Tools like JAWS or NVDA help visually impaired users navigate websites.
- Color Contrast Checkers: Tools such as WebAIM’s Contrast Checker ensure text is readable against backgrounds.
The Importance of Responsive Design – Web Design & Development
Definition and Benefits:
Responsive design ensures that a website adapts seamlessly to various screen sizes and devices, enhancing user experience and engagement.
User Behavior Insights:
Statistics indicate that mobile device usage has surpassed desktop, highlighting the need for a seamless experience across all devices. Additionally, according to Statista, over 50% of global website traffic now comes from mobile devices.
Techniques and Frameworks:
- CSS Techniques: Media queries allow different styles for different devices.
- Frameworks: Bootstrap and Foundation provide pre-designed components to streamline responsive design.
Testing for Responsiveness:
- Tools: Utilize tools like Google’s Mobile-Friendly Test and BrowserStack to check how websites perform on various devices and screen sizes.
Content Management Systems (CMS) Overview
What is a CMS?:
A Content Management System (CMS) is software that enables users to create, manage, and modify content on a website without requiring specialized technical knowledge.
Popular CMS Platforms:
- WordPress: Ideal for blogs and small businesses, with extensive plugins and themes.
- Joomla: Suitable for more complex websites needing additional functionality.
- Shopify: Tailored for e-commerce, offering easy-to-use tools for online selling.
Benefits of Using a CMS:
- Ease of Use: Most CMS platforms have user-friendly interfaces.
- Flexibility: Users can customize their sites easily.
- Community Support: Popular platforms have active communities providing help and resources.
Choosing the Right CMS:
Consider project needs, budget, and scalability when selecting a CMS. Also, assess technical skills and desired features to find the best fit.
Utilizing Color Psychology in Web Design – Web Design & Development
Understanding Color Psychology:
Colors can significantly influence emotions and behaviors. For example, blue is often associated with trust, while red can evoke urgency.
Color Theory Basics:
The color wheel consists of primary (red, blue, yellow), secondary (green, orange, purple), and tertiary colors, each creating different moods and aesthetics.
Choosing Colors for Branding:
Select a color palette that reflects brand identity and resonates with the target audience. For instance, a health brand might use green for its associations with nature and well-being.
Case Studies:
- Coca-Cola: Uses red to create excitement and energy, aligning with its brand identity.
- IKEA: Utilizes blue and yellow to evoke feelings of trust and friendliness, enhancing customer perception.
The Impact of SEO on Web Design
SEO Basics:
Search Engine Optimization (SEO) involves optimizing a website to improve its visibility on search engines. Additionally, good SEO practices can drive more organic traffic to a site.
Design Elements that Affect SEO:
- Site Structure: A clear hierarchy aids navigation and improves crawlability.
- Mobile-Friendliness: Responsive designs are favored by search engines.
- Page Load Speed: Faster sites improve user experience and search rankings.
On-page Optimization Tips:
- Optimize images by reducing file sizes and using alt tags.
- Use clean, descriptive URLs.
- Incorporate relevant meta tags for better visibility.
Tools for SEO Testing:
- Google Search Console: Helps monitor and troubleshoot site performance.
- SEMrush: Offers insights on keywords and competitors, helping to refine SEO strategies.
Choosing the Right Web Development Framework – Web Design & Development
Overview of Web Development Frameworks:
Web development frameworks provide pre-written code to simplify and streamline the development process, allowing for faster and more efficient web application creation.
Popular Frameworks:
- React: Great for building user interfaces with reusable components; popular in single-page applications.
- Angular: A comprehensive framework for dynamic web applications, favored for its robust tooling.
- Vue.js: A progressive framework that’s easy to integrate with projects and known for its flexibility.
Factors to Consider:
Consider project size, team expertise, and long-term maintenance when selecting a framework. Furthermore, each framework has unique advantages and community support, which can influence choice.
Future Trends:
Emerging frameworks like Svelte and technologies such as Jamstack are gaining traction, promising improved performance and user experience in future web development practices.
Conclusion: Web Design & Development
By staying informed about these trends and best practices, businesses can create a robust web presence that stands out in the crowded digital environment. Leverage the power of web design & development to not only attract users but convert them into loyal customers.